Here is Sadie's story...

On January 6, 2015, our little girl entered this world far too soon.  Born at 25 weeks and 2 lbs, 2 oz., Sadie entered the world silently without the ability to take a breath on her own.  Sadie was born with respiratory distress syndrome, two heart defects, and retinopathy of prematurity in her eyes.  Needless to say she had constant ups and downs during her 3-month stay in the NICU. We were terrified but hopeful.  I learned a whole new language as I watched the doctors and nurses care for her around the clock and was amazed by the care she received.  Sadie directly benefitted from the work of March of Dimes through treatments she received, including the surfactant she received in the first 24 hours of life which helped her lungs and enabled them to recover from RDS.  

Today Sadie is 10 years old, in 4th Grade, plays lacrosse and basketball, loves to learn, and has received her "all clear" from her cardiologist. She is a feisty, funny little fighter and we are amazed every day!! But we know there is a long road ahead for many more impacted be prematurity.
